Weronika Gęsicka, ShowOFF Section 2016 winner, presented her new projects to the experts and public during Plat(t)form 2018, organised by the Fotomusem Winterthur. Her presentation has been chosen as one of the best ones of this year’s edition.
Diana Lelonek is a ShowOFF Section 2014 winner and artist, whose works has been presented as part of the Krakow Photomonth 2017 Main Programme. Recently, she has been nominated to the “O” Prize 2018, in the visual arts and photography category for the project A New Archaeology for Liban and Płaszów, which has been presented during the 15th edition of Krakow Photomonth 2017.
